Termite Control

Termites can remain hidden while feeding on wood and other cellulose materials inside a structure. By the time visible damage appears, a colony may have been active for months or even years. Mud tubes, damaged wood, discarded wings, and swarming termites can all indicate that an inspection is needed.

Rodent Control

Rats and mice can enter through surprisingly small openings while searching for food, water, and shelter. Once inside, they may contaminate stored products, damage insulation, chew wiring, and create sanitation concerns. For restaurants, hotels, apartments, and other businesses, rodent activity can also put customer trust and reputation at risk.

Pantry & Stored-Product Pest Control

Weevils, grain beetles, flour beetles, Indian meal moths, and other stored-product pests can infest flour, cereal, rice, grains, nuts, pet food, spices, and other dry goods. In homes they can quickly spread from one package to another, while in restaurants, kitchens, warehouses, and food-storage areas they can create serious sanitation and product-loss concerns.

Bed Bug Control

Bed bugs are difficult to eliminate because they hide in narrow cracks, furniture, mattresses, wall voids, and other protected areas. They can be carried into homes, apartments, hotels, and other properties on luggage, clothing, furniture, and personal belongings. Their presence is not necessarily a reflection of cleanliness.

How can I tell what kind of pest is on my property?

Droppings, damage, nesting materials, tracks, discarded wings, bites, sounds, and the location of the activity can all provide clues. Because different pests can leave similar signs, a professional inspection is often the best way to identify the problem correctly.
